    The Hub Bicycle Company is a friendly full-service bike shop featuring a carefully blended batch of bikes from Giant, Kona, Scott, Co-Motion, Mosaic, Independent Fabrication, and Virtue Bicycles. The foremost experts on tandem cycling and service in St. Louis and the Midwest, The Hub specializes in fun, fitness, and exceptional customer satisfaction. The Hub Bicycle Company operates the premier bicycle repair shop in the metro area. Our experienced repair staff remains trained in the ever-changing technical side of cycling to be ready to keep your bike rolling. The Hub Bicycle Company also has a well-attended group road ride to which all are invited. The Saturday Morning Road Ride heads westward from the shop and uses cycling-compatible roads nearby. Three different start times accommodate beginner, intermediate and advanced riders. Complimentary bagels and coffee are served after the ride.       The Sturmey Archer hub on my Biktrix Stunner bit the dust last fall. It was sold as a durable component of my 750 watt mid drive, but was not (Sturmey Archer recently specifically warned against this use).

      So, I found an e bike specific Shimano 5 speed IGH and aksed the Hub to order it for me, and lace it to a wheel. They did so, with the correct trim and expertly.

      The resulting wheel was not perfect I had to make 2 trips to get all of the little parts on correctly. But what impressed me was their service attitude to provide me with essentially a custom assembly - THIS WAS NOT A KIT. Example: My last part was delivered to my house by a Hub employee, at their behest.

      The wheel was installed on my Biktrix Stunner in January and has been my main transport mode for months now. It performs flawlessly.
